Technical Problem
In the prior art, it is difficult to automatically install the support rails pre-assembled with terminal blocks in the switch cabinet, resulting in high installation costs and inconvenience.
Method used
A fixing device is used, which includes a fixing element and a locking device. The linear movement between the support rail and the fixing element is achieved through rotational movement, so that the support rail is pushed into the rear engagement part and is tensioned, and the rear engagement part and the locking device are used to achieve gap-free fixation.
Benefits of technology
The supporting rail pre-assembled with the wiring terminals is fast and easy to fix on the surface, which reduces the installation cost and improves the installation efficiency.

Abstract
The invention relates to a fixing device (100) for fixing a support rail (200) on a surface (400), comprising a fixing element (110) that can be fixed on the surface (400), the fixing element having a support rail support surface (112) for supporting the support rail (200) and a support rail fixing section (115), wherein the support rail fixing section (115) in the fixed state at least partially passes through an opening (212, 213) formed in the support rail (200), and wherein the support rail fixing section ( 115) has a rear engagement portion (116) into which a section (211) of a support rail (200) is pushed in a fixed state, and has a locking device (150), wherein the locking device (150) has a locking element (151) which is constructed so that a linear movement (B) is performed between the fixing element (110) and the support rail (200) by a rotational movement of the locking element (151), thereby pushing the support rail (200) into the rear engagement portion (116) of the support rail fixing section (115) and tensioning it.
